| + // CJK names have reverse order (surname goes first, given name goes |
| + // second). |
| + {"홍 길동", "길동", "", "홍"}, // Korean name, Hangul |
| + {"孫 德明", "德明", "", "孫"}, // Chinese name, Unihan |
| + {"山田 貴洋", "貴洋", "", "山田"}, // Japanese name, Unihan |
| + |
| + // CJK names don't usually have a space in the middle, but most of the |
| + // time, the surname is only one character (in Chinese & Korean). |
| + {"최성훈", "성훈", "", "최"}, // Korean name, Hangul |
| + {"강전희", "전희", "", "강"}, // Korean name, Hangul |
| + {"刘翔", "翔", "", "刘"}, // (Traditional) Chinese name, Unihan |
| + {"劉翔", "翔", "", "劉"}, // (Simplified) Chinese name, Unihan |
